A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Y OF MARYSVILLE STATING ITS
INTENTION TO ANNEX THE GRIFFORE PROPERTY INTO THE CITY
AND TRANSMITTING THE MATTER TO THE SNOHOMISH COUNTY
BOUNDARY REVIEW BOARD FOR APPROVAL.
WHEREAS,on November 6,1989 the City of Marysville received
a petition for the annexation of certain property known as the
"Griffore property"located east of Sunnyside Boulevard and south
of 56th Street N.E.,said property being legally described in
Exhibit A attached hereto;and
WHEREAS,a duly-advertised pUblic hearing was held on said
petition before the Marysville City Council on November 27,
1989,and said city Council was fully advised in the premises;
NOW,THEREFORE,BE IT RESOLVED B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E
CITY OF MARYSVILLE,WASHINGTON AS FOLLOWS:
Section 1.The above-described property is hereby approved
for annexation into the City of Marysville and shall be so
annexed by ordinance of the City immediately upon receipt of a
favorable report from the snohomish County Boundary Review Board.
Section 2.Upon annexation of the above-described property
it shall be assessed and taxed at the same rate and on the same
basis as other property within the City of Marysville,including
assessments or taxes for the payment of its pro rata share of all
outstanding indebtedness of the city contracted or incurred prior
to,or existing on,the effective date of the annexation.
section 3.Upon annexation of the above-described property
the City will simultaneously adopt the following Comprehensive
Plan designations for the same:
Single-Family Residential 12,500 for the southeast
portion of the annexation territory which is located
south of 52nd Street N.E.and east of 67th Avenue N.E.
Single-Family Residential 9600 for the balance of the
annexation territory,
section 4.The preliminary plats of Eastwood Hills and
Sunnyside East have been approved by Snohomish County and are
within the proposed annexation territory.Upon annexation the
City agrees to honor said plats sUbject to the same conditions
imposed by the Snohomish County Hearing Examiner and subject to
the following additional conditions:

a.The plats shall be required to comply with TIP 89-
2.
b.At the time of recording the final plats they
shall each be required to fulfill their voluntary
promise to pay the city a park fee of $200 per
lot.
c.At the time of recording the final plats they
shall each be required to fulfill their voluntary
promise to pay the Allen Creek Diking District a
mitigation fee of $125 per lot.
d.Recording of the final plats shall be processed
through the city of Marysville,including payment
of final plat fees,inspection fees and the
submittal of performance bonds and guarantee
bonds.
Section 5.The city Attorney is hereby authorized to
transmit all files on this annexation proceeding to the Snohomish
County Boundary Review Board for consideration;provided,that
the property owner shall be responsible for any and all costs
incurred in this proceeding.
